To illustrate this, let's plot her observations on a graph. When we plot the data, we realize there is a linear relationship between ... WebJun 21, 2024 · Prefixes. To tell the difference between extrapolation and interpolation, we need to look at the prefixes “extra” and “inter.”. The prefix “extra” means “outside” or “in addition to.”. The prefix “inter” means “in between” or “among.”. Just knowing these meanings (from their originals in Latin) goes a long way to ... rooftop bar schwabing

WebCurve Fitting, a numerical method of statistical analysis is a very good example of both interpolation as well as extrapolation.In it, a few measured data points are used to plot a mathematical function, and then, a known curve that fits best to that function is constructed. Since the shape of the fitted curve is known, it can even be extended ... WebExtrapolation is an attempt to apply the model too far outside the range of the data. For instance, if your model is based on salaries that range only between $30K and $50k, then you should not attempt to use it to predict at that a salary level of $100K – we simply do not have any information at that salary value.
